Inter are working to extend the contract of midfielder Giovanni Fabbian until the end of June 2027.

This according to Italian news outlet FCInterNews, who report that the Nerazzurri are keen to secure the 19-year-old’s future as they start to plan for his next move after the end of the current season on loan with Reggina in Serie B.

Fabbian has been one of the in-form players in Serie B this season, with the young midfielder more than proving that he is ready for the step up to senior professional football after shining with Inter’s Primavera team last season.

The Calabrians would like to bring the 19-year-old back next season, and in the event that they are promoted to Serie A there is a very good chance that his loan will be extended.

However, the Nerazzurri are also considering other possibilities, including recalling him to their first team, or another loan move to continue his development.

In any event, Fabbian’s current contract runs until the end of June 2026, but the Nerazzurri are keen to extend this a further season as they certainly consider him to be an important player for the future.
